Green hydrogen is too expensive — these 38 government policies are needed to make it viable

Landmark report unveiled at COP26 by the International Renewable Energy Agency and the World Economic Forum sets out 38 'enabling measures' that will help cut the cost of renewable H2 in Europe and underpin a trustworthy international market
